Daddy's Money

1996 single by Ricochet From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Remove ads

"Daddy's Money" is a song recorded by American country music group Ricochet. It was released in April 1996 as the second single from their self-titled debut album. The song reached Number One on the Billboard Hot Country Singles & Tracks chart in July 1996.[1] The song was written by Bob DiPiero, Mark D. Sanders, and Steve Seskin.

Critical reception

In a review of the band's career, Billboard magazine called the song an "infectious uptempo romp."[2]

Music video

This was their first music video, and it was directed by Marc Ball. It premiered on CMT on April 24, 1996 during The CMT Delivery Room. A portion of their debut single "What Do I Know" is played at the beginning of the video.

Chart performance

"Daddy's Money" debuted at number 63 on the U.S. Billboard Hot Country Singles & Tracks for the week of April 27, 1996.
